A recently concluded special constituency meeting of the South Philippine Union Conference (SPUC) voted to split the territory into two distinct union organizations.
The church work in the SPUC territory is growing rapidly, and it demands more close supervision, monitoring, quick assessment, and evaluation, regional leaders said. They reported that as the second-largest island of the Philippines, Mindanao has 97,530 square kilometers (37,660 square miles) of land area.
“Since its organization in 1964, it remains a vast challenge for travel from one end to another, not to mention the staggering distance and traffic conditions, despite the opening of new highways and bypass roads,” leaders reported. “The splitting of the territory into two organizations, therefore, is the best option to fulfill the mission of the church.”
